John Rusnak

August 2, 1922 — April 20, 2014

John G. Rusnak, age 91, of Bristol Township, passed away on April 20, 2014, at Silver Lake Nursing Home. Born in Passaic, NJ, he was a long-time resident of Bristol Borough before moving to Bristol Township over 25 years ago. John proudly served his country in the U.S. Army during World War II in the 99th Infantry Division. He was a former employee of Kaiser Metal Co. in Bristol, and retired from Strick Trailer in Langhorne, PA. John always enjoyed working with his hands. He spent most of his retirement years making metal tools on his lathe and milling machine. He also spent countless hours tending to his vegetable garden; sharing fresh vegetables with family and friends. He was preceded in death by his parents John and Helen (nee: Sargent) Rusnak; and brother George Rusnak.   He will be greatly missed by his sister Olga Gdyra; brother Emil Rusnak and his wife Angie (nee: DiPalma); and many loving nieces and nephews.
